Skanska awarded additional contract for state-of-the-art R&D facility in USA for USD 70 M, about SEK 480 M


Skanska and a joint venture partner have been awarded an additional contract as
construction manager of the state-of-the-art research and development facility
in the USA, that was previously announced. Skanska’s 50 percent share is USD 70
M, about SEK 480 M, included in the order bookings for Skanska USA Building in
the fourth quarter of 2012.
Skanska anticipates additional amendments to the contract as subsequent work and
associated prices are agreed to. Skanskas part of those additions will be in the
order bookings for Skanska USA Building in the quarter in which they are signed.

Skanska USA is one of the leading development and construction companies in the
country, consisting of four business units: Skanska USA Building, which
specializes in building construction; Skanska USA Civil, specialized in civil
infrastructure; Skanska Infrastructure Development, which develops public
-private partnerships; and Skanska Commercial Development, which develops
commercial projects in select U.S. markets. Headquartered in New York, Skanska
USA has approximately 9,400 employees and its 2011 revenues were SEK 31.3
billion.

Throughout 125 years, Skanska has been a modern and innovative developer and
contractor, building what society needs. Today, Skanska is one of the world’s
leading project development and construction groups with expertise in
construction, development of commercial and residential projects and public
-private partnerships. Based on its global green experience, Skanska aims to be
the clients' first choice for Green solutions. The Group currently has 53,000
employees in selected home markets in Europe, in the US and Latin America.
Headquartered in Stockholm, Sweden and listed on the Stockholm Stock Exchange,
Skanska's sales in 2011 totaled SEK 123 billion.
